Abstract: A scroll compressor is provided that may have a first sealing portion defined between an inner surface of an orbiting wrap and an outer surface of a non-orbiting wrap facing the inner surface of the orbiting wrap in a radial direction, and a second sealing portion defined between an inner surface of the non-orbiting wrap and an outer surface of the orbiting wrap facing the inner surface of the non-orbiting wrap in the radial direction. Further, sealing surfaces where the wraps facing each other are in surface-contact with each other may be formed on at least one of the first sealing portion or the second sealing portion. This may enlarge a sealing area between side surfaces of the wraps facing each other to suppress or prevent leakage of refrigerant suctioned in a compression chamber, thereby improving indicated efficiency and volumetric efficiency.

Abstract: A scroll compressor is provided that may include a first back pressure unit that allows a refrigerant to flow from a first compression chamber to a back pressure chamber while blocking a reverse flow of the refrigerant, and a second back pressure unit that allows the refrigerant to flow from the back pressure chamber to a second compression chamber while blocking a reverse flow of the refrigerant. The first back pressure unit and the second back pressure unit may be spaced apart from each other in a direction that the compression chambers are formed. This may reduce pressure pulsation in the back pressure chamber. Also, leakage between compression chambers may be suppressed and simultaneously friction loss may be reduced by appropriately adjusting the pressure in the back pressure chamber. This is especially advantageous for enhancing compression efficiency under low load operating conditions (or in a low pressure ratio operation).

Abstract: A scroll compressor is disclosed. The scroll compressor may include a suction guide between a refrigerant suction pipe and a high/low pressure separation plate, and the suction guide may be fastened to a non-orbiting scroll or inserted into a suction guide protrusion that extends from the non-orbiting scroll. Accordingly, suction refrigerant may be partially suctioned into a compression chamber by the suction guide in advance before moving to the high/low pressure separation plate, so as to be prevented from coming into contact with the high/low pressure separation plate, while the suction refrigerant may also partially flow toward a drive motor without being suctioned directly into the compression chamber, so as to cool the drive motor, whereby efficiency of the compressor may be improved and an operation range of the compressor may be expanded.

Abstract: A scroll compressor is provided that may include first and second variable-capacity units that provide communication between a first intermediate pressure chamber and a low-pressure portion and between a second intermediate pressure chamber and the low-pressure portion. The first variable-capacity unit may include a first variable-capacity passage that communicates with the intermediate pressure chamber, at least one first variable-capacity valve that opens/closes the first variable-capacity passage, and a first variable-capacity opening and closing valve that controls opening/closing of the at least one first variable-capacity valve, and the second variable-capacity unit may include a second variable-capacity passage that communicates with a second intermediate pressure chamber, at least one second variable-capacity valve that opens/closes the second variable-capacity passage, and a second variable-capacity opening and closing valve that controls opening/closing of the at least one second variable-capacity valve.

Abstract: A scroll compressor includes a discharge guide disposed in a high-pressure part to guide refrigerant discharged from a compression part to a refrigerant discharge pipe, and the discharge guide may extend by a preset height from an inner circumferential surface of a casing constituting the high-pressure part toward one side surface of a high and low pressure separation plate. This can guide discharge refrigerant discharged to the high-pressure part to quickly flow to the refrigerant discharge pipe before being spread in an entire space of the high-pressure part, thereby preventing the high and low pressure separation plate from being overheated by discharge refrigerant of high temperature. This can result in preventing suction refrigerant of a low-pressure part from being heated by heat of discharge refrigerant transferred through the high and low pressure separation plate, thereby reducing a specific volume of the suction refrigerant and improving compressor efficiency.

Abstract: A scroll compressor may include a casing configured to receive a rotation shaft and a driving unit; a compression unit provided with a frame configured to rotatably support the rotation shaft, a first scroll fixed to the casing, and a second scroll configured to be connected to the rotation shaft and engaged with the first scroll. An oldham ring is provided with a plurality of key portions to guide the second scroll to perform an orbiting movement, wherein at least one of the frame, the first scroll, and the second scroll includes a respective key groove formed to receive a respective key portion; and a respective wear-resistant member mounted to cover an inner surface of the respective key groove in contact with the respective key portion.
